A24 Media, 70 content generators since launch

Nation Media Group, a multimedia house in East and Central Africa, is the latest broadcaster to become associated with A24 Media, joining K24, a 24-hour Kenyan news channel, and Royal Media Services, an electronic media house in Kenya.

Other African broadcasters who have joined forces with A24 Media are: Ethiopia's Gem TV, Seychelles Broadcasting Corporation and the Southern African Broadcasting Association (SABA), a membership organisation representing public service and other broadcasting organisations in 13 countries in the Southern African Development Community (SADC) region. The partnership with SABA has expanded A24 Media's capacity to source content from the continent.

Asif Sheikh, CEO and co-founder of A24 Media expressed delight with the uptake of the service by the broadcasters and content generators who have signed up so far, “We are positioned very well strategically to change the stories that are seen and heard about Africa, both within the continent and outside it; and therefore to transform the image of our continent positively. I'm very excited about the possibilities for A24 Media, and we invite journalists, broadcasters and companies to be a part of this great venture.”

Since its launch in September, A24 Media has incorporated diverse content generators including 66 freelancers spread over 17 countries as well as eight NGOs spread over three countries. Some of the NGOs include AMREF, UNICEF, UNEP, Action Aid and the Mohamed Amin Foundation. A24 is focusing on diversifying its content and continues to grow from strength to strength as it seeks to engage broadcasters from all across the continent.
